When you hunt for a wireless lavalier kit, the core concerns revolve around microphone pickup, transmission stability, and ease of use. The right system delivers natural, intelligible speech without sounding overly bright or muffled, even when the presenter moves. You should evaluate the mic capsule type, the design of the transmitter, and how the receiver integrates with your camera, mixer, or recording device. Look for features that protect against noise and interference, such as balanced output, robust shielding, and smart auto‑level control. A thoughtful selection balances sound quality with practical considerations like battery life, range, and setup time.
A common mistake is prioritizing range over clarity. While a longer reach is helpful on a stage, it can invite dropouts and hiss in crowded venues. Focus on signal integrity within the typical spaces you record in, whether a quiet studio, a bustling event hall, or an outdoor setting. Check the mic’s polar pattern to understand how it handles off‑axis speech. Cardioid capsules are versatile for solo presenters, while subcardioid or hypercardioid designs may reduce ambient noise. Consider the comfort of the lavalier itself, its wind protection, and how discreet it appears when worn.
Real‑world testing considerations for consistent audio performance
Before buying, map out your usual recording scenarios and highlight potential interference sources. Nearby wireless networks, Bluetooth devices, and even microwave ovens can affect performance, so understanding your environment helps you choose a model with robust diversity or frequency‑hopping capability. Some systems broadcast on multiple frequencies and switch channels automatically to avoid interference, which can dramatically improve reliability. If you shoot in mixed environments, a kit with automatic frequency management reduces the chance of a sudden drop in audio. Always verify that the kit includes a clear, consistent signal with minimal noise across its operating range.

You should also assess how well the system handles transmitter motion. Many wireless packs struggle when the wearer moves rapidly or turns their head. A well‑designed unit maintains compression stability and preserves voice tonal balance, even as you pivot, squat, or lean. Check the mic’s capsule placement and how it clips to clothing; a design that stays in place reduces handling noise and cable noise. Battery life matters too, particularly for long runs or multi‑hour events. Look for a conservative rating that includes actual tested runtime with typical workflows, not just a lab figure.
How to optimize setup for mobility and comfort
In real use, compatibility with your recording chain is essential. Some wireless kits provide clean analog outputs, while others offer digital, which can reduce noise but may require extra adapters. Make sure the receiver’s output level matches your recorder’s line input or camera mic preamp, and consider if phantom power is necessary or if single‑battery operation suffices. A convenient interface for quick setup can save time on busy shoots. If you plan to use wireless in conjunction with lavalier mics of different sensitivities, you’ll want adjustable gain and high‑pass filtering to prevent rumble and proximity effect from muddying the sound.

Build quality is another factor that affects long‑term reliability. Metal housings, solid connectors, and a weather‑resistant design extend the life of your gear in field work. Some kits include detachable antennas or diversity receivers that help maintain a strong link as you move around a room. Consider the mount options for the lavalier mic, including a discreet tie‑on clip, magnetic fasteners, or skin‑safe adhesives for sensitive wearers. A compact, lightweight package reduces fatigue during extended shoots and minimizes the chance of accidental dislodging.

Optimizing your setup starts with microphone placement. Place the lavalier about two to four inches below the chin, toward the chest, and avoid rubbing against clothing or jewelry that can create rustle. You should experiment with distance to maximize intelligibility without boosting breath noise. Some people prefer a slightly off‑axis angle to capture a more natural voice tone. Use wind protection when outdoors to cut wind noise, and ensure the clip or adhesive does not irritate sensitive skin over long sessions. Keep cables invisible or neatly routed to prevent accidental tugging that could interrupt a take.
Training and rehearsal play a crucial role in achieving consistent sound. Run a quick test at your actual recording spot, noting how the system responds to movement, lighting, and ambient noise. If you hear hums or crackles, verify grounding and connector integrity, and swap out cables where appropriate. Check how the system behaves when another wireless device is operating nearby. Practicing with a real script helps you learn the best mic position per speaker and quickly adjust gain to preserve dynamic range, ensuring the final mix remains clean and natural.

Budgeting wisely means understanding the trade‑offs between price and performance. A mid‑range kit often delivers excellent voice clarity and reliable transmission for standard interviews and events, while premium options add features like multi‑channel recording, more precise balancing, and enhanced durability. If you anticipate frequent travel or outdoor shoots, investing in weatherproofing or rugged housings can be cost‑effective in the long run. Also consider support and firmware updates; a product with ongoing developer attention tends to stay compatible with newer cameras and audio interfaces, reducing future upgrade costs.
Warranty coverage and service options are worth examining. Look for a manufacturer that offers a solid replacement policy, responsive technical support, and clear troubleshooting steps. Some brands provide calibration and testing services, which can keep a wireless kit performing at peak. If you rely on the system for professional gigs, a service plan that includes loaner equipment during repairs minimizes downtime. Finally, read independent reviews and user feedback to gauge real‑world reliability beyond the specs sheet, focusing on experiences in environments similar to yours.
When you’re ready to decide, list the features you actually need: channel count, battery life, range, and ease of pairing with your devices. Evaluate the user interface—whether the menu is intuitive and quick to navigate during a shoot matters more than you might expect. Also ensure the kit’s accessories suit your workflow, including spare clips, lav mics, windshields, and a robust carrying case. The best choice balances practical usefulness with solid build quality, minimal interference, and comfortable wearability for extended sessions.
If possible, borrow or demo a kit before committing to purchase. Hands‑on testing in your typical shooting scenarios provides the most trustworthy read on audio quality and reliability. Listen closely for natural vocal warmth, breath handling, and consistency as movement increases. Assess how the system behaves around other electronics and at the edges of its advertised range. A well‑chosen lavalier kit with wireless transmitter will deliver dependable clarity with minimal distraction, supporting confident delivery and professional broadcasts across many settings.
